"Don't look!" Flying Eagle tried to cover Bai Qianqian's eyes, but it was too late.

"She's been dead for a while now," Liu Xiao concluded after a glance. "She hit the corner of the table and died from excessive brain hemorrhage. It seems the culprit is a scoundrel even worse than a beast!" Anger surged to his head.

"What exactly happened? Oh, and where's Mei'er?" Bai Qianqian ran out excitedly and knocked on the door of the house across the street.

As expected, Lin Bao had come; Bai Qianqian's guess was correct. After pushing down Mei'er's mother, Lin Bao kidnapped Mei'er.

"That scumbag! Let's go save Mei'er!" After finding someone to settle Mei'er's mother's body, the three of them headed straight for Lin Family Fortress—Lin Bao's location.

After entering the fortress, the three of them charged recklessly, kicking or striking anyone who stood in their way. As for the lackeys, Flying Eagle showed no mercy.

He showed no mercy but delivered a swift and decisive blow, severing the throat with a single, clean stroke.

Inside a room in the inner courtyard of Linjiabao.

"You beast, don't come any closer!" Mei'er glared at Lin Bao with hatred. This damned man had cruelly pushed her mother down. Mei'er was incredibly worried and afraid, wondering how her mother was doing. In this world, only her mother and she had each other left to depend on.

"Hmph, you damned woman, it's one thing to jump into the river, but you even dared to take in those two people who offended me! You're courting death! Today I'll show you what I'm capable of!" With that, he pounced on Mei'er.

"No! Help!" Mei couldn't escape and was caught red-handed.

"Hmph, save it. Do you think anyone will come to save you? Let me tell you the truth, those two so-called saviors of yours are people who have been put under the execution order by His Highness Absolute Kill. I've already notified the people of Absolute Kill Hall, and they're probably already on their way to the Western Paradise by now, hahaha..." Lin Bao said smugly while tearing at Mei'er's clothes, not even noticing the approaching footsteps outside.

"So, you're saying the assassins from the Hall of Absolute Killing were sent by you?" A voice, seemingly from hell, filled with barely concealed rage, rang out behind him.

Lin Bao, who was busy with his business, shuddered—such a strong murderous aura!

"Young Master Bai! Save me!" Seeing Bai Qianqian appear, Mei'er broke free while Lin Bao was trembling and rushed towards Bai Qianqian.

Looking at the sobbing girl in her arms, Bai Qianqian helplessly hugged her tighter. Although she didn't like women crying, and even less so about women crying so closely in front of her, she would bear it for the sake of the girl's recent misfortune. However, she would find another way to vent; she wouldn't let herself suffocate.

"You deserve to die!" Thinking of Bai Qianqian's near-death experience, Flying Eagle wished he could tear Lin Bao to pieces right now.

"Stop!" Seeing Flying Eagle about to unleash a deadly attack, Bai Qianqian shouted, "Arrest him first and cripple his martial arts!" She thought of Mei'er's mother, a kind and loving woman, who had died so tragically, and of Flying Eagle and herself who had almost lost their lives. Bai Qianqian's anger surged.

"Mei'er, I have something to tell you, and I hope you are mentally prepared..." Seeing Mei'er's frail appearance, Bai Qianqian found it hard to say.

"Is something wrong with my mother? Please tell me, how is my mother? Is she badly injured?" Mei asked anxiously.

"She, your mother..." No, I still can't bring myself to say it.

"Your mother lost too much blood and died when we arrived at your house," Flying Eagle stated bluntly, his voice flat but carrying a hidden murderous intent. He stared at Lin Bao, whose martial arts had been crippled; the man was terrified and exhausted.

"What? No, this isn't real, I don't believe it! Mother!" After her initial grief, Mei'er ran excitedly to Lin Bao, punching and kicking him. "You beast, you'll die a horrible death! You bastard, give me back my mother, give me back my mother!" Until she was exhausted from beating and crying, Mei'er gradually fell into a deep sleep.

"Flying Eagle, you've dealt with him. Liu Xiao, could you hold her for me?" Seeing that Mei'er had fallen asleep, Bai Qianqian gently handed her to Liu Xiao...

Chapter Twelve: An Awkward Confession

Several days passed, and Bai Qianqian comforted Mei'er daily, telling her all sorts of jokes, finally dispelling the gloom in Mei'er's heart. Gradually, Mei'er began to smile again. However, whenever she thought of her deceased mother, she still couldn't help but shed tears. At these times, Bai Qianqian would always gently and then humorously cheer her up.

Gradually, Mei'er's gaze towards "Young Master Bai" took on a special gleam, though Bai Qianqian didn't notice.

"Don't you think Bai Qianqian is a very peculiar woman?" Liu Xiao couldn't help but chuckle as he watched Bai Qianqian playfully teasing Mei'er. In just a few days, they were like old friends. Privately, they all called her Qianqian, which sounded affectionate. Besides, Bai Qianqian truly didn't have the airs of a palace master. She was usually very lively and approachable, only putting on airs when she suddenly felt she should act like a palace master or give orders.

"Yes, she is different from others." Flying Eagle looked intently at Bai Qianqian, a hint of tenderness flashing in his eyes.

"Heh, is it just different? Nothing else?" Liu Xiao teased with a smile.

"What do you mean?" He was somewhat inclined to avoid the question.

"You know it yourself, don't you?" Liu Xiao turned to look at Fei Ying, a meaningful smile in his eyes.

The eagle fell silent, its thoughts swirling, but ultimately it remained silent.

A few more days passed, and Bai Qianqian decided to leave and go to Lengyue Manor in Yingtian Prefecture to broaden her horizons.

"Mei'er, I'm sorry, we can't stay with you anymore." Bai Qianqian felt helpless as she said goodbye when everyone was in a good mood.

"Young Master Bai, are you leaving?" Mei'er suddenly stopped smiling and looked at her benefactor with unease.

"Yes, I've been here for quite a while now, it's time to go," Bai Qianqian said apologetically.

"Young Master Bai, if, if you must leave, can you take me with you? I am willing to be your slave, just to be by your side!" Mei'er asked anxiously.

"Well, aren't you supposed to be managing the business here?" Bai Qianqian's gaze towards Mei'er seemed off, and subconsciously she wanted to decline, offering a flimsy excuse.

"Business here has been failing for a long time. Does Young Master Bai despise me?" Mei'er asked sadly, tears streaming down her face.

"No, that's not it, don't cry!" Bai Qianqian felt utterly helpless; she disliked seeing women cry the most. "I... how could I let you become my servant?" After so many days together, she already considered her a sister.

"Young Master Bai, you..." Mei'er blushed upon hearing this.

Oh no, judging from her expression, she might have misunderstood! Bai Qianqian's heart sank further. "No, it's that... I've always considered you family, like a younger sister. Hehe."

"Young Master Bai..." Despite falling from heaven to hell, Mei'er still mustered her courage and blurted out what was on her mind. "Young Master Bai, I... I actually fell in love with you the moment you rescued me from the water. And as we spent time together, my feelings for you only grew stronger. I know I am unworthy of you, so I am willing to be your servant, just to be by your side, to see you often, and to take care of you. That would be enough for me."

"I'm sorry, you've misunderstood." Bai Qianqian decided to tell Mei'er the truth quickly and decisively. "I'm actually a woman just like you."

"Huh? You, you're kidding, right?" Mei'er's eyes widened in disbelief as she looked Bai Qianqian up and down.

"I'm sorry, but it's true. Wait for me a moment!" After saying that, Bai Qianqian quickly went into the inner room to change her clothes. In order to avoid people realizing that she was not from this time or thinking that she was a monster or something, she never used modern high-tech products in front of others.

A moment later, an exceptionally beautiful woman emerged from the inner room.

"Ah! You!" Mei stared in astonishment at the stunning beauty before her, as if floating on clouds. It took her a long time to recover. "My God, you're so beautiful!"

"Thank you, it's not that exaggerated, haha." Bai Qianqian smiled shyly. But she was secretly delighted.

"Miss Bai... please take me with you and leave this place. I have no one to rely on here anymore, and this place holds painful memories for me. I... I want to leave. Please, Miss, let me be your servant!" Mei'er suddenly knelt down and pleaded. The misunderstanding was cleared up, and Mei'er, knowing that her secret crush was actually a woman, actually felt a sense of relief. Perhaps the seemingly hopeless love had put immense pressure on her.

"Well... if you insist, then I'll agree. But we might encounter danger, and I don't want to be a burden to you. Please reconsider?" Bai Qianqian reluctantly agreed, but still wanted to persuade Mei'er.

"Thank you, Miss. I will definitely take good care of you. I'm not afraid of any danger. My life was saved by you, Miss, and you even avenged my mother. I'm sticking with you. As long as you don't mind, that's enough," Mei'er said confidently.

"No, how could I possibly dislike you?" Hmm, it seems persuasion is ineffective. Looking at the pretty and sweet-looking Mei'er, Bai Qianqian started daydreaming again. (Hmm, having a beautiful woman in the gang isn't bad, but it would be even better if there was a cold, aloof, and loyal woman with high martial arts skills. She could even be paired with a handsome guy from her gang, making them even closer, hehe. Hmm, I'll have Flying Eagle teach Mei'er martial arts sometime, hehe.)

Chapter Thirteen: Leaving Xiangyang

Early the next morning, four riders sped out of Xiangyang City, heading north towards Nanjing Yingtianfu. The four handsome men, each with their own unique features, were the focus of attention for passersby. It was Bai Qianqian and her companions; even Mei'er was disguised as a man this time, all for the sake of convenience.

"Ugh, riding a horse is so tiring! Let's take a break!" Bai Qianqian exclaimed. She then reined in her horse and walked towards a shady spot by the roadside.

Does she look tired? Mei'er, on the other hand, looks pale and panting. Liu Xiao immediately knew that Bai Qianqian was resting for Mei'er's sake, and he felt even more favorably toward Qianqian. He then dismounted, helped Mei'er rein in her horse, and fed her a stimulating pill.

"Thank you, Brother Liu, I feel much better." Mei'er gratefully curtsied to Liu Xiao.

“We’re all family, no need to be so polite,” Liu Xiao replied with a smile.

The eagle remained silent throughout, its gaze sweeping over the surroundings before occasionally drifting towards Bai Qianqian.

"Come on, it's so hot, have some chilled watermelon!" It was already July or August, and the heat was unbearable. They had just come from a long journey and were feeling suffocated by the heat. Bai Qianqian took out a chilled watermelon that she had put in a compartment of a compressed bag, cut it up, and distributed it to everyone.

"Huh? Where did this iced watermelon come from?" Mei'er asked first.

"Huh? Hehe, well... I conjured it up." It's best not to explain to a curious person, lest they pry and ask endless questions. Just give them a bluff if you can.

"How did it come to be? It's amazing!" Mei'er was determined to get to the bottom of it.

"Huh? This..." Why are you asking? Bai Qianqian decided to adopt the demeanor of a palace master to suppress her curiosity. "This is a secret passed down to me as the palace master of Xiaoyao Palace. Only the next palace master has the right to know it. So..." Her expression was charming and proud.

"I'm sorry, I overstepped my bounds!" Mei'er had never seen Bai Qianqian like this before, and she was a little frightened.

"Hehe, it's okay, I was just kidding." Bai Qianqian immediately returned to her friendly demeanor.

"Palace Master, may I also ask a joke?" Liu Xiao saw that Fei Ying looked thoughtful as he looked at Bai Qianqian and wanted to tease him.

"It seems I have to answer your questions. Go ahead and say it!" Qianqian smiled at Liu Xiao.

"Is Bai Ke, who saved you that day, your lover?" Liu Xiao's direct question struck Flying Eagle like a thunderbolt, making him jump. Mei'er, who was the least able to hide her surprise, opened her mouth wide and stared at Liu Xiao with wide eyes.

"Hehe, you could say it or you could say it isn't. Why would you ask such a question?" Bai Qianqian frowned, puzzled by Liu Xiao's sudden question. Xiao Ke was the embodiment of her idol.

"Hehe, Palace Master, don't take it to heart. Just treat it as a joke." It could be said that way, or it could not... what does it mean? Liu Xiao looked at Flying Eagle with a mixture of encouragement and worry.

I, Bai Qianqian, didn't come here to find love. But... if I really meet someone even more handsome than Xiao Ke, then I might consider it, haha. (The following is a daydream...)

"By the way, from now on, you can call me Qianqian in private. Calling me Palace Master still sounds weird to me. I thought I'd get used to it after hearing it a lot, but I still don't feel comfortable with it." After saying a lot, Bai Qianqian got thirsty and started eating some cool and sweet watermelon.

"Alright, then I'll call you by your name. Qianqian, head in the direction you're going. You'll pass through Qingyang City in Zhengzhou. Qingyang City is a melting pot of all sorts of people, and its intelligence network is incredibly efficient, but it also has a lot of spies from various countries. Sometimes, dignitaries from different nations will appear there, and assassinations are frequent. Are you sure you want to go?" Those assassins sometimes prefer to kill a hundred innocent people rather than let one guilty person go free; if they were targeted, things could get very bad. It wasn't that he didn't trust his own life, but he was genuinely worried about Qianqian and Mei'er.

"Really?! Great! I definitely want to see it!" Although there were live-fire drills in previous shooting training, nothing could compare to the thrill of an assassination in the dark. Bai Qianqian's eyes lit up with excitement.

"Well... alright, let's go to Qingyang!" Liu Xiao looked at Fei Ying. But Qianqian's decision meant only hardship for them. He conveyed his message to Fei Ying with his eyes, but the eagle remained steadfastly focused on Bai Qianqian. She was his master, the person he would protect with his life; that was all he needed to know.

"How long does it take to get to Qingyang from here?" Bai Qianqian asked expectantly.

"At the current speed, it should take about two more days to arrive," Eagle replied calmly and swiftly.

"By the way, Flying Eagle. You've come here before to assassinate some dignitaries, haven't you?" Liu Xiao asked with some concern. "If they discover your identity..." He was referring to spies from various countries and the vast intelligence network of the Assassination Hall.

"Hehe, Flying Eagle, you're quite famous now?" Bai Qianqian smiled at Flying Eagle. "But it's alright, I have something that can disguise me. I can just change my appearance!" Bai Qianqian gave her body-cloning system to Flying Eagle and taught him how to transform into other people's appearances.

"Alright, let's head to Qingyang City!" Bai Qianqian pointed boldly at Qingyang and pulled on the reins.

Four fine horses galloped away, raising a cloud of dust...

Chapter Fourteen: Prosperous Qingyang

With Bai Qianqian's anticipation, they entered Qingyang City in less than two days.

"Wow! What day is it today? It's so lively!" Bai Qianqian and Mei'er looked at the festive decorations around them with delight.

"These gentlemen are visiting Qingyang City for the first time, aren't they? Hehe, no wonder you don't know. These days are Qingyang City's triennial talent selection competition. As long as you have the ability, regardless of your background, you can participate in the competition, whether it's literary or martial arts. The top three will not only receive a generous reward of one thousand taels of silver, but will also be offered an official position. If you are lucky enough to be noticed by some high-ranking official, you'll be set for life." The waiter from Xiangmanlou Restaurant introduced the competition enthusiastically, his expression as if he had been among the top three himself.

"Hehe, waiter, bring out some of your best dishes!" Although Bai Qianqian was also very interested in the talent selection competition, delicious food was more important right now. (So where did Bai Qianqian's silver come from? Hehe, of course, it came from the 32nd century. Certain planets in the 32nd century had discovered vast quantities of silver, which was considered garbage material then. Since silver was a common currency in ancient times, Bai's father packed several tons into his daughter's compression bag. If you're worried about the weight, just ask her.)

(Bai Qianqian: "What, you're asking if the compression bags are too heavy? No, thank you for your concern. There's a gravitational magnetic field inside the compression bags, so the things you put in float like they're in space, and you won't feel any weight.")

"Alright, everyone, just a moment, the food will be here soon, I guarantee you'll be satisfied!" the waiter called out loudly before leaving.

After lunch, the four of them went shopping at Qianqian's strong suggestion.

"Wow, Qingyang is much more lively than Xiangyang." In Xiangyang, I'm always dealing with Lin Bao and those assassins from the Death Hall; I don't have time to stroll around properly. However, Qingyang is indeed much more prosperous than Xiangyang.

Even the luxurious Xiangmanlou Restaurant, considered one of the best in Xiangyang, is only located on the outskirts of the city's bustling downtown area. The downtown area itself comprises nine main streets and sixteen smaller streets. The nine main streets are lined with shops selling specialty goods from various countries, as well as their own high-quality products. Domestic shops offer a wide variety of precious medicinal herbs, tea, rhinoceros horn and ivory carvings, fine silk, porcelain, and hardware. Foreign shops mainly represent neighboring Dali, Western Xia, Jin, Western Liao, and Tubo; further afield are shops from Zhenla, Arabia, Qin, Persia, Baida, and Majia. A dazzling array of specialties are available, including coral, agate, pearls, frankincense, glass, hawksbill turtle shell, northern pearls, ginseng, furs, and horses. The sixteen smaller streets are filled with mid-range goods and local snacks from various countries, as well as flea markets.
